Understanding At-Home Laser Hair Removal Technology
At-home laser hair removal devices have revolutionized personal care, offering a convenient and potentially cost-effective alternative to professional treatments. However, understanding the technology is crucial before investing. The most common technologies used in these devices are Intense Pulsed Light (IPL) and laser. While both aim to reduce hair growth, they differ significantly in their approach. IPL devices emit a broad spectrum of light, targeting a range of chromophores (pigment molecules) in the hair follicle. Lasers, on the other hand, use a single, concentrated wavelength of light, often targeting melanin specifically. This difference impacts effectiveness, treatment time, and potential side effects. Choosing the right technology depends on your skin and hair type, and a thorough understanding is key to finding the *best at-home laser hair removal* solution for you.
IPL vs. Laser: A Detailed Comparison for At-Home Use
The core difference between IPL and laser at-home hair removal lies in the light source. IPL uses a broad spectrum of light, while lasers utilize a single, specific wavelength. This affects the treatment's precision and effectiveness.
IPL Advantages: IPL devices are generally more affordable than at-home lasers. They are also often easier to use, with some models offering larger treatment windows for faster sessions.
IPL Disadvantages: Because of the broader spectrum of light, IPL treatments might be less effective for those with darker skin tones or lighter hair. The broader range can also lead to a slightly higher risk of skin irritation.
Laser Advantages: Lasers offer greater precision, targeting melanin more directly. This translates to potentially more effective hair reduction, particularly for certain skin and hair types. They are often favored for their ability to treat a wider range of skin tones effectively.
Laser Disadvantages: Laser at-home devices are usually more expensive than IPL devices. They may also require more precise application, demanding a bit more technique and potentially lengthening treatment time.

Choosing the Right At-Home Laser Hair Removal Device: Key Factors to Consider
Selecting the *best at-home laser hair removal* device requires careful consideration of several key factors:
Skin Tone: This is crucial. Devices are typically categorized based on suitable skin tones. Using a device unsuitable for your skin tone can lead to burns or other skin damage. Check the manufacturer's guidelines carefully.
Hair Color: Darker hair absorbs light more effectively, making treatment more successful. Lighter hair might require more sessions or might not respond as well. Some devices are better suited for treating specific hair colors than others.
Hair Thickness: Thick, coarse hair generally requires more intense treatment than fine hair. Consider the device's energy levels and pulse settings to ensure suitability for your hair type.
Treatment Area: The size of the treatment window (the area covered with each flash) directly impacts treatment time. Larger windows mean faster sessions. Consider the size of the areas you wish to treat.
Budget: Prices vary widely depending on the technology, features, and brand. Set a budget beforehand to narrow your options effectively.
Reviews and Ratings: Before purchasing any device, thoroughly research reviews and ratings from other users. Look for feedback on effectiveness, ease of use, and side effects.
Safety Precautions and Potential Side Effects of At-Home Laser Hair Removal
While generally safe, at-home laser hair removal devices carry some risks. Understanding and following safety precautions is paramount:
Patch Test: Always perform a patch test on a small, inconspicuous area of skin before treating larger areas. This helps identify any potential allergic reactions or sensitivities.
Skin Preparation: Follow the manufacturer's instructions carefully for skin preparation before treatment. This often involves shaving the treatment area and avoiding sun exposure beforehand.
Eye Protection: Always wear the protective eyewear provided to prevent eye damage.
Sun Sensitivity: After treatment, avoid direct sun exposure for at least 24-48 hours. Use sunscreen with a high SPF.
Potential Side Effects: Possible side effects include temporary redness, swelling, and mild discomfort. In rare cases, more serious side effects like blistering or hyperpigmentation might occur. Seek medical advice if you experience any unusual or severe reactions. Maintaining Results: Post-Treatment Care and Expectations
To maximize the effectiveness and longevity of your at-home laser hair removal results:
Consistent Use: Follow the manufacturer's recommended treatment schedule for optimal results. Consistency is key.
Sun Protection: Regularly use sunscreen with a high SPF to prevent hair regrowth and protect treated skin.
Touch-Up Treatments: Expect some hair regrowth over time. Touch-up treatments are often necessary to maintain results.
Realistic Expectations: At-home devices generally provide noticeable hair reduction, but complete hair removal might not be achievable for everyone.

FAQ: At-Home Laser Hair Removal
Q: How long does at-home laser hair removal take?
A: The treatment time varies depending on the size of the treatment area and the device’s flash speed. It can take several minutes to several hours for larger areas.
Q: How many treatments do I need for noticeable results?
A: The number of treatments varies greatly depending on your hair type, skin tone, and the device’s effectiveness. You’ll typically need multiple sessions spaced several weeks apart.
Q: Is at-home laser hair removal painful?
A: Most users describe the sensation as a mild snapping or tingling. Some devices offer cooling features to minimize discomfort.
Q: How much does at-home laser hair removal cost?
A: The cost varies widely depending on the brand, technology, and features of the device. Expect to invest from several hundred to several thousand dollars.
Q: Can I use at-home laser hair removal on all parts of my body?
A: Most devices are suitable for various body areas, but always check the manufacturer's recommendations before treatment. Some areas might be more sensitive or require more caution.
Q: Are there any long-term side effects?
A: With proper use and safety precautions, long-term side effects are rare. However, improper use can lead to skin damage.
Q: How do I choose the right device for my skin and hair type?
A: Refer to the manufacturer's guidelines and consider factors like skin tone, hair color, and thickness. Consult reviews and compare various devices before making a decision.
Q: What is the difference between IPL and laser at-home hair removal devices?
A: IPL uses a broad spectrum of light, while laser uses a single wavelength. Lasers often offer greater precision and efficacy but are generally more expensive.
